There's an etap with no staff, you put your card in a machine and it prints your room pass-worked well when I got across at that time and was only about €30. It's in the same place as all the other hotels so easy to find, 2mims off the tunnel or ferry

Also Formule 1 hotels; similar to etap but they aren't exactly spectacular places (one in Calais is a bit of a concrete block prison).
As said though, anywhere decent just let them know in advanced; the receptions are usually staffed throughout the night anyway.
